Nayeli graduated from Duke University with a Bachelor of Arts in History and a certificate in Latin American and Caribbean Studies. She’s gained experience through roles at Democracy North Carolina, Duke Wellness, Define America, Jumpstart, and several law firms. On campus, she’s been a leader in Lambda Theta Alpha and co-taught a course on local philanthropy. Nayeli began coming to the Emily K Center in the 8th grade and credits individualized advising with supporting her growth academically, professionally, and personally. One of her favorite memories is speaking (and cutting the ribbon with Coach K!) at the Center’s building expansion ceremony. Now, she’s studying for the LSAT, working toward paralegal certification.
